FSU shooting: At least six people were wounded in a mass shooting today at Florida State University in Tallahassee, according to a local hospital. One patient is in critical condition while the other five were described as serious.

• Suspect in custody: Police have taken at least one person into custody. Officers found a handgun on the suspect, as well as a shotgun in the school’s student union and another gun in the suspect’s car, according to a law enforcement official.

• What it’s like on campus: Three hours after the first emergency alert about the shooting went out, FSU is continuing to urge students to shelter in place as law enforcement works to clear rooms across the campus. All classes and school events are canceled through tomorrow, the school said.
